What happened

Tenant applied for an order determining that the Landlord substantially interfered with the reasonable enjoyment of the rental unit or residential complex by the Tenant or by a member of their household, and harassed, obstructed, coerced, threatened or interfered with the Tenant. The issue was related to the Tenant's loss of key access to a rear fire door of the residential complex.

The ruling

The Tenant's application is dismissed as the Tenant did not prove the allegations of substantial interference and harassment on a balance of probabilities.
